About Target Hospitality Corp.
Target Hospitality Corp. operates as a specialty rental and hospitality services company in North America. It operates through Hospitality & Facilities Services South, Workforce Hospitality Solutions, and Government segments. The company owns a network of specialty rental accommodation units. It also provides catering and food, maintenance, housekeeping, grounds-keeping, security, health and recreation facilities, workforce community management, concierge, and laundry services. In addition, the company offers construction services. It serves the U.S. government contractors and investment grade natural resource development companies. Target Hospitality Corp. was founded in 1978 and is headquartered in The Woodlands, Texas.
